Innovation Hypothesis Intro: Balkanization of Resources

Companies grow nonlinearly and respond to disruption primarily through innovative efforts.  Innovative efforts require diverse resources--primarily talent and various types of funding.  An innovative effort lacking any one required resource will fail.  When companies divide management of those required resources among various managers, any one manager can stop any particular innovative effort.  And if all innovative efforts receive all but one necessary resource, even if each effort fails to obtain something different, no innovation will take place.
